Loggerhead Sea Turtle
ESPECULADOCaretta caretta
A massive oceanic turtle whose nesting females haul themselves onto Leonida's Atlantic beaches each summer.
The Loggerhead is Leonida's most common nesting sea turtle, with tens of thousands of nests laid each summer along the Atlantic coast. Their massive heads house jaws powerful enough to crush conch shells, their primary food. Strictly protected by state and federal law.
